The stretch of the road from Laiuse to Pedja is covered in gravel.
Laiuse – a church (first documented in 1319), the present building dated from the 18th century, a lime-tree planted by Charles XII, a straw workshop, a graveyard and a monument of liberty.
Laiuse Drumlin is the highest point of the county (144 m above the sea level).

The ruins of Laiuse Order Castle are located on the side of the Jõgeva-Laiuse Highway.
In the late Middle Ages Laiuse castle, the first fortification for defence with firearms in Estonia, was completed.

 The Great Snow Battle of Laiuse, Feb 2006
Apparently the King of Sweden Karl XII ordered his troops to stage a huge snowfight when he and his army stayed at the Laiuse castle during the winter of 1701.
The King of Sweden was in the middle of waging war against Russia at the time, but a brief recess in the war allowed him to try out some new strategies he had thought of whilst also allowing his soldiers to have some fun in the process.
In honour of this rather curious historical event - a massive and coordinated snowfight involving a whole army - the Laiuse Snow Battle now takes place in the very same spot (in the midst of the ruins of the former Laiuse castle) more than 300 years later.

Day 6: A half day trip from the Laiuse to the Kuremaa (distance around 30 km).Laiuse Castle of Order was built most probably during the 14 and 15 century from bricks and field stones in style of camping castle.
During the Great Northern War just after the Battle of Narva (1700-1701) the king of Sweden Carl XII chose Laiuse as his winter residence.
The castle was destroyed during the same war.

In the 1870-s joining gymnastics into national movement took place.
In 1876 parish clerk and schoolteacher Jüri Soo organized the first Estonian gymnastics festival at Laiuse, in the district of Jõgevamaa.
He took the gymnastic festivities in Tartu of German gymnastic societies as an example.
